  • Shibuya: Located a mere 3.2km from Shinjuku, Shibuya is a lively neighbourhood renowned for its youthful spirit and urban charm. Families and outdoor enthusiasts flock here to experience the iconic Shibuya Crossing, one of the busiest pedestrian intersections in the world. The area is filled with trendy shopping malls, boutique stores, and vibrant shopping streets. Visit the famous Hachiko statue and explore the surrounding tourist precincts and squares that are perfect for people-watching and soaking in the local culture. Shibuya's lively atmosphere makes it a must-visit destination.
